Built in 1886, St. Jakob Church in Aachen is the first stop for pilgrims on the Camino de Santiago starting from Aachen Cathedral.
Quick Facts
- Founded
- 1886
- Architect
- Heinrich Johann Wiethase
- Architectural Style
- Neo-Gothic
- Heritage Status
- Architectural Heritage Monument
